ALLENDALE, Mich. – Roosevelt was swept Friday night by No. 21 Grand Valley State in a Great Lakes Intercollegiate Athletic Conference match in Allendale, Mich.
The visiting Lakers (1-15, 0-7 GLIAC) never led in the match, but made sure the hosts felt the pressure for much of the evening. Roosevelt fell behind 5-0 in the opening set, but cut the deficit down to 16-14 before falling 25-21. Grand Valley State won 25-15 in the second set then pulled away for a 25-19 win in the third.
Alessia Isgro led the Lakers with six kills and
Abigail Wutka had five kills.
Nekane Parera was part of three of Roosevelt's four blocks in the match, and
Isa Grana served up three aces to lead the way from the service line.
Cydney Martinez paced the Lakers with 11 digs.
